Jane believes that she got a bad grade on her psychology paper because her professor doesn’t like her. Jane most likely has an _______ locus of control.
To determine Jane's locus of control, we need to understand her perception of the cause of her bad grade. If Jane believes that external factors, such as her professor's personal feelings towards her, are responsible for her grade, then she has an external locus of control. On the other hand, if Jane believes that her own actions and efforts are the primary factors influencing her grade, then she has an internal locus of control.
In this case, since Jane attributes her bad grade to her professor's dislike for her, it suggests that she has an external locus of control. Therefore, the most likely answer is b. external.
